You’re Not Alone!
The festive period can be difficult on your mental health. Whether or not Christmas is part of your life, your mental health might be affected by it happening around you. It’s a time of year that often puts extra pressure on us, and can affect our mental health in lots of different ways.
There are many services that can help if you are finding the festive period particularly difficult.
Contact your GP for support, alternatively here are some services in the local area:
The Samaritans – 116 123 (Free to call)
State Of Mind – www.stateofmindsport.org
MIND – www.mind.org.uk
Lee Cooper Foundation (ages 11-24) – www.theleecooperfoundation.co.uk
Think Well Being Halton (psychological therapies) www.nwbh.nhs.uk/think-wellbeing-Halton
In a mental health crisis please call 999
